Skipworth (ankle) was transferred to the 60-day DL on Sunday.
This procedural roster move will allow the Reds to open up a spot on the 40-man roster for Sunday's starter, Tim Adleman. Skipworth will continue to rehab his injury in the meantime, though the odds of seeing meaningful time at the major league level this season remain slim.
